Beckham Garden was established in 2006 in memory of The Rt Revd William A Beckham 6th Bishop of the Episcopal Diocese of Upper South Carolina. Features include a crepe myrtle recognised by the city as both a treasured tree and grand tree due to its historical significance and size and Rodgers Fountain dedicated to founding church members John Bryan Rodgers and Hattie Radcliffe Rodgers and their children. In addition to the large crepe myrtle and the fountain, the garden features a manicured lawn, flowers and shrubs, and four benches
